The WoW Token Unveiled
In 2015, Blizzard Entertainment introduced a groundbreaking feature to World of Warcraft (WoW) – the WoW Token. This was a game-changer, y’know, as it allowed players to exchange real money for game gold. You could buy a WoW Token with your hard-earned cash, then sell it in the auction house for gold. That’s right, a token for gold.
But that’s not all. You could also reverse the process. If you’d amassed a small fortune in game gold, you could use it to buy a WoW Token from the auction house. Then, you could redeem that token for additional game time. To summarize, gold for game time.
Token prices, though, they weren’t fixed. They depended on supply and demand within each region’s auction house. So, the amount of gold you could get for a token, or how much game time a heap of gold could buy you, that could fluctuate.

How WoW Token Influences Economy
You might not realize it, but WoW Tokens greatly influence the game’s economy. By providing a legal, in-game method for players to convert real money into virtual currency, they help to control inflation. This is because the price of WoW Tokens isn’t fixed. It’s set by the game’s developers, but it fluctuates based on supply and demand.
When there’s high demand for Tokens and a low supply, the price goes up. Conversely, if there’s a surplus of Tokens and fewer players willing to buy them, the price goes down. This creates a self-regulating economy, preventing the gold market from becoming too inflated or deflated.
Furthermore, WoW Tokens help to cut down on illegal gold farming. Since players can now buy gold legally through Tokens, there’s less incentive to buy it from illegal sources. This reduces the amount of gold that’s pumped into the economy from these sources, helping to maintain balance.
